Two dynamic musical acts headline show at VCA

Two dynamic musical acts, Jesse Sykes with Phil Wandscher and Mike Dumovich, will perform at 7:30 p.m. Saturday on the Kay White Hall stage.

Vashon native son Dumovich is a singer-songwriter and storyteller who’s worked on previous records and shows with such artists as Eyvind Kang, Laura Veirs, Bill Frisell and Josh Tillman. He is also known for producing fundraisers to support charitable island organizations. His impressive guitar picking expresses the soulful depth of his pensive music, with imagery and metaphors in his lyrics that evoke the pastoral life of Vashon. This concert marks the launch of his fourth album, “The Copper Thieves.”

The New York Times described the music of Jesse Sykes and Phil Wandscher as “spellbinding.” Rolling Stone magazine called it “utterly transfixing.” The two musicians have toured extensively with Iron And Wine, Marissa Nadler, Earth and Father John Misty and have shared the stage with Steve Earle, Lucinda Williams and Gillian Welch. Sykes and Wandscher are recording their fifth album with their band The Sweet Hereafter.

Sykes and Dumovich have been longtime champions of each other’s music.
